# Basement Archive Room — Night Access

The archive room under Pellworth House holds old contracts and the tape backups. Night shift: take stairwell C, not the lift (it's switched off after midnight). Lights are on a timer by the door — slap the button as you go in. Sign the logbook, even at 3am, yes really. The keypad by the door takes the code below.

staff pass of fahap-tajeg = bdg-FT-6

Quick note for whoever inherits LedgerLoom's export path: the spreadsheet exporter was buffering entire workbooks in memory, which blew up on Penthaven's 400k-row reports. We switched to chunked streaming with a bounded row cache and a flush threshold. Don't "optimize" these back up without load-testing against the big fixtures first. The current tuning constants are listed below.

limits module of yadug-bahip:
QUOTAS = {
    "oliath": 10,
    "holath": 5,
}

Handover note — night shift

Tomas, quick handover before I head out. The hardware lab on B1 is mid-calibration; the Quillon rig must stay powered, so don't trip the bench breaker. Parts delivery for the sensor batch is logged and shelved, cage three. The main lab reader is glitchy and rejects badges on the first swipe — try twice. If it refuses entirely, the keypad on the rear door still works. The current code is below.

door code, yagap-bahof: bdg-O-05

Environment Variables — Quillshade EXIF Scrubber (plugin authors). Plugins run inside the scrub sandbox and inherit a filtered environment. Variables prefixed QS_PLUGIN_ are visible to your code; everything else is stripped. The host process itself authenticates to the Quillshade metadata-removal backend at startup, independent of plugins. That host-level credential is defined in the service env file on the line that follows.

vault entry, yahif-yajep: COURIER_KEY29=b802bdf8034096b65a51c6ba5abe2